Verified Details on Matthew Perry and Public Mourning
Matthew Perry was widely recognized for his candidness about personal struggles and his advocacy around addiction and recovery. His passing prompted widespread reflection, including from colleagues who credited him with changing conversations around mental health in entertainment. The use of #friends aligns with broader practices of online mourning, where audiences and peers come together to confirm shared values and humanize public figures.
